Dies ist eine alte Version des Dokuments!
Dieser Handler erstellt Prozessvariablen mit Benutzerinformationen des Nutzers, der den letzten Task einer Aktivität erledigt hat.
com.dooris.bpm.actionhandler.WriteLastTaskFinisherInVariableHandler
node-leave
beliebig
leer
Name der Variable in die der User geschrieben werden soll.
Hier werden die Benutzerinformation definiert, die zurückgegeben werden sollen. Mögliche Werte sind: Email, ID, Name, firstname, lastname Um mehrere Werte abzufragen, müssen diese Komma getrennt definiert werden. Die Benutzerinformationen werden anschließend in Variablen mit dem zugehörigen Suffix geschrieben.
lastFinisherVariable=mail_user
userAttribute=Email
Ergebnis:
Prozessvariable
mail_user=Hans.Muster@firma.de
lastFinisherVariable=mail_user
userAttribute=Email,ID
Ergebnis:
mail_user_Email=Hans.Muster@firma.de
mail_user_ID=543
lastFinisherVariable=mail_user
userAttribute=Email,Name,Vorname,Nachname
Ergebnis:
mail_user_Email=Hans.Muster@firma.de
mail_user_Name=Hans.Muster
mail_user_Vorname=Hans
mail_user_Nachname=Muster